Elections are in the news a lot lately, not only for who runs and who wins, but for how they are operated and how secure the results are.

Westporters interested in working at the polls for the upcoming elections – or simply interested in how they run – are invited to a free workshop at 2:30 p.m. tomorrow at the Westport Center for Senior Activities, 21 Imperial Road, Westport.

Westport’s registrars of voters, Deborah Greenberg and Marie Signore, will discuss how they prepare for and run the process; results of the last election, including an election audit and recount results; and how early voting is working, as well as information about the upcoming August primaries, and fall 2026 election.

The hourlong program is presented by the Westport League of Women Voters. To learn more, send an email to lwvwestportct@yahoo.com.
